## [Unreleased]

## [v3.1.0] - 2018-02-18

### Added
- 'Distance Between Two Points' calculator now draws great circle between the two points.
- Points drawn on sphere now disappear when they rotate around the back of the sphere.
- Added mid-point calculation (and visuals) to 'Two Coordinate Geodesics' calculator.

### Changed
- Updated changelog to 'Keep a Changelog' standards, closes #159.

- Renamed 'Distance Between Two Points' calculator to 'Two Coordinate Geodesics'.

intermediatePointCoordinates: function() {
if(!this.distance)
return ''
const p1Lat = this.point1Coord.GetLat_rad()
const p1Lon = this.point1Coord.GetLon_rad()
const p2Lat = this.point2Coord.GetLat_rad()
const p2Lon = this.point2Coord.GetLon_rad()
const f = parseFloat(this.intermediatePointFraction)
const d = this.distance/this.geospatial.EARTH_RADIUS_M
var A = Math.sin((1-f)*d)/Math.sin(d)
var B = Math.sin(f*d)/Math.sin(d)
var x = A*Math.cos(p1Lat)*Math.cos(p1Lon) + B*Math.cos(p2Lat)*Math.cos(p2Lon)
var y = A*Math.cos(p1Lat)*Math.sin(p1Lon) + B*Math.cos(p2Lat)*Math.sin(p2Lon)
var z = A*Math.sin(p1Lat) + B*Math.sin(p2Lat)
var intPointLat = Math.atan2(z,Math.sqrt(Math.pow(x,2)+Math.pow(y,2)))
var intPointLon = Math.atan2(y,x)
var intPointCoord = new Coordinate()
intPointCoord.SetLat_rad(intPointLat)
intPointCoord.SetLon_rad(intPointLon)
return intPointCoord
},
